Nancy “Hank” Deschner Martin passed away on December 14, 2021, after a short illness of pneumonia. She was 87 years old. She has 2 surviving daughters Donna Berggren of Crestline, OH and Judy Williams of Lucas, Oh, 7 grandchildren Mauri Smith, Mindy Wymer, Eric Berggren, Kyle Berrgren, Christopher Heinberger, Matthew Williams, Daniel Williams, 16 great grandchildren and a great great grandchild. Sister Mattie Pickens and many close family members to include but not limited to Debrorah Ells, Steven McAllister, Patricia McAllister Brame, Terrance and Sonya McAllister and Kim Lynch.
Nancy was born in Saltville, Virginia spending most of her adult life in Mansfield, Oh. She had many business adventures most known for the original proprietor of Deschners Pizza, The Hair Affair and The Chatterbox. Her many hobbies included painting, cake decorating, bowling, bingo, traveling and gardening. After retirement weather permitting, spring to fall she was in the follower or garden bed many hours of the day. If summarizing someone’s life in 2 short paragraphs is all that is left, then may I add the love and compassion that she gave and showed to those that knew her including all the beloved pets she had over the many years and “Princess” her surviving Miniature Australian Shepard.
